TSS9131A

REPLY “YES” OR “FORCE” OR “ABORT”

Reason:

When a local system attempts to lock the Security File, the structure name in the Security File ENQ record is compared to the local system's currently defined structure. A local system, which is not connected to the Coupling Facility, has attempted to lock the Security File when the ENQ record has a currently active structure name and the local system has a different structure name. The operator is prompted to confirm whether the local system should connect to the active structure or whether all systems should be disconnected from XES and the local system should connect using the local system's currently defined structure name.

This message includes the option to reply ABORT only if the message was issued during startup. If this message is issued after initialization completes, the operator is not given this option.

Action:

Reply YES to connect to active structure, or FORCE to disconnect all systems from active structure and then connect to the local system's currently defined structure name. Reply ABORT to abort the attempt by the local system to lock the Security File.
